Among Ancient Romans, bestiarii (singular bestiarius) were those who went into combat with beasts, or were exposed to them.It is conventional to distinguish two categories of bestiarii: the first were those condemned to death via the beasts (see damnatio ad bestias) and the second were those who faced them voluntarily, for pay or glory (see venatio). The other known meaning for the term bestiarii is that these people were actually the animal keepers or managers of the amphitheaters. Bestiarii, as reported by Seneca, consisted of young men who, to become expert in managing their arms, fought sometimes against beasts, and sometimes against one another; and of bravos who, to show their courage and dexterity, exposed themselves to this dangerous combat. I think we can likely assume that the fighting style of the bestiarii was focused on keeping the animal at range using their spear, ideally looking to puncture a vital point, an artery or maybe an eye or throat on the animal bearing down on them. There are various murals that depict then with spears and this was likely a common weapon, cheap to make and disposable for the criminals and war prisoners, who were not really expected to win. Augustus encouraged this practice in young men of the first rank; Nero exposed himself to it; and it was for killing beasts in the amphitheatre that Commodus acquired the title of the Roman Hercules. regulus.
